Hey all! Just wanted some input as to what classes you all would think each character in Derek Landy's novels would be!
I've got a bunch built but I'm curious as to what everyone else thought; Ghastly as a Monk/Fighter, Skulduggery as a Sorcerer/Fighter, China as a Scribes Wizard... no Character is too obscure!
Well, I’d say that Skul-man would actually be a wizard, as would most of the “sorcerers,” because while they have natural tendencies toward magic, it requires so much study that they are basically wizards. Skulduggery would likely be a Wizard (necromancy) using the unofficial rules for subclass multiclassing into an evocation wizard or multiclassed into a sorcerer. Valkyrie would also be a wizard, though her school would change depending on what book you are reading. Pre-Darquesse she would be similar to Skulduggery, but once she got her new powers maybe she would be a Wild Magic sorcerer with a unique ability that allows her to steal magic from others, similar to the Arcane Trickster rogue. I agree with your analysis of Ghastly, but I would actually consider him more of a monk (four elements)/Wizard (evocation), though not many levels in that, and you could probably get away with just having him be a four elements monk, though a fighter with the unarmed fighting fighting style and the eldritch knight subclass or some multiclassing in evocation wizard would work as well. China is definitely the unofficial rune wizard or possibly even a mystic. Fletcher is obviously a conjuration wizard. The Dead Men are all wizards multiclassed with fighters or perhaps some are bladesingers or multiclassed with rogues. Any seers are divination wizards. Gordon Edgley is a bard, though his abilities likely are not magical in nature. I can come up with more characters if you want. Finally, keep in mind that everyone (in this list) is human, with three exceptions. Gordon is a shade (unofficial kobold press race), Skulduggery is a reborn or Matt Mercer’s Hollow One, and Valkyrie is a tiefling, though she has no outward traits of being one and no fire resistance.
